Bug 57517 - apt-conf-netpolice: оставляет устаревший .rpmnew файл после создания рабочего конфига, создавая путаницу
Summary: apt-conf-netpolice: оставляет устаревший .rpmnew файл после создания рабочего...
Status: CLOSED WORKSFORME
Alias: None
Product: Sisyphus
Classification: Development
Component: apt-conf-netpolice (show other bugs)
Version: unstable
Hardware: x86_64 Linux
: P5 normal
Assignee: Ajrat Makhmutov
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2026-01-16 18:36 MSK by Клёсов Никита Константинович
Modified: 2026-01-16 18:56 MSK (History)
2 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Клёсов Никита Константинович 2026-01-16 18:36:33 MSK
Пакет:
apt-conf-netpolice-1.0.1-alt1

Стенд, обновленный до Sisyphus:
alt-s-education-11.0-x86-64-xfce

Шаги: 

   1. # apt-get install apt-conf-netpolice
   2. # apt-repo

Ожидаемый результат:
   
   После установки пакета в выводе apt-repo присутствует репозиторий NetPolice:
   rpm http://repo.netpolice.ru/altlinux/p10/branch x86_64 cair

Фактический результат:

   После установки пакета репозиторий NetPolice НЕ отображается в выводе apt-repo.
Пакет создает конфигурационный файл /etc/apt/sources.list.d/netpolice.list.rpmnew
вместо /etc/apt/sources.list.d/netpolice.list, поэтому репозиторий не активируется.

Дополнительно:

   Если после шага 1 выполнить:
# mv /etc/apt/sources.list.d/netpolice.list.rpmnew /etc/apt/sources.list.d/netpolice.list
в списке подключенных репозиториев присутствует:
   rpm http://repo.netpolice.ru/altlinux/p10/branch x86_64 cair
Также ошибка воспроизводится в alt-education-11.0-x86-64-kde,xfce (не обновлены до Sisyphus).
Comment 1 Ajrat Makhmutov 2026-01-16 18:56:25 MSK
Не баг. rpmnew файл создаётся тогда и только тогда, когда ты от рута лезешь в /etc/apt/sources.list.d/netpolice.list